Application data

Outdoor installation — Units approved for outdoor in-
stallation only.
Ductwork — Secure vertical discharge ductwork to roof
curb. For horizontal discharge applications, either attach
ductwork to unit, or use field-supplied flanges attached to
the horizontal discharge openings and attach all ductwork
to flanges.
Horizontal discharge — To convert from vertical dis-
charge to horizontal discharge (Durablade economizer
only):
1. Remove economizer or two-position damper to gain
access to return duct opening.
2. Move the horizontal-discharge duct opening covers to
the vertical discharge openings.
3. Rotate economizer or two-position damper 90 degrees.
4. Rotate the barometric relief damper 90 degrees.
5. Install block-off plate over the opening on the access
panel.
Horizontal EconoMi$er — A field-installed accessory
for horizontal discharge applications. Field-installed power
exhaust accessory also available for vertical or horizontal
EconoMi$er applications.
Thru-the-bottom power connections — For applica-
tions requiring thru-the-bottom connections, Carrier acces-
sory thru-the-bottom package must be purchased to ensure
proper connections.
Thermostat — Use of 2-stage heating and cooling ther-
mostat is recommended for all units. A 2-stage cooling
thermostat is required on units with accessory economizer
to provide integrated cooling.
Heating-to-cooling changeover — All units are auto-
matic changeover from heating to cooling when automatic
changeover thermostat and subbase are used.
Airflow — Units are draw-thru on cooling and blow-thru
on heating.
Maximum airflow — To minimize the possibility of con-
densate blow-off from indoor coil, airflow through units
should not exceed 500 cfm/ton on 004-012 units.

Minimum airflow — For cooling, minimum airflow is
300 cfm/ton. For 50TFQ units with electric heating,
required minimum cfm is 900 for 50TFQ004; 1200 for
50TFQ005; 1500 for 50TFQ006; 1800 for 50TFQ007;
2250 for 50TFQ008; 2500 for 50TFQ009; and 3000 for
50TFQ012, with the following exceptions:

Minimum ambient cooling operating temperature
— The minimum temperature for standard units is 25 F.
With accessory Motormaster® control, units can operate
at outdoor temperatures down to –20 F.
Internal unit design — Due to Carrier's internal unit
design (draw-thru over the motor), air path, and specially
designed motors, the full horsepower (maximum contin-
uous bhp) listed in the Physical Data table and the notes
following each Fan Performance table can be utilized with
confidence.
Using Carrier motors with the values listed in the Physi-
cal and Fan Performance Data tables will not result in nui-
sance tripping or premature motor failure. The unit
warranty will not be affected.
Apollo direct digital controls — The Apollo direct digi-
tal controls must be used with either a Carrier master or
monitor thermostat.
Carrier
PremierLink™
PremierLink controls can be used with any thermostat.
